TikTok Secures Agreement to Continue Operations in the U.S.

TikTok announced it is in the process of restoring its service in the United States following assurances from President Donald Trump to the platform’s service providers. 

The video-sharing app, which serves over 170 million Americans and supports more than 7 million small businesses, expressed gratitude for the clarity provided by the Trump administration.

The agreement resolves concerns surrounding potential penalties for companies providing services to TikTok, which had faced threats of a ban over national security concerns. The company framed the development as a victory for free speech, stating, “It’s a strong stand for the First Amendment and against arbitrary censorship.”

TikTok also indicated its commitment to working with the Trump administration to establish a long-term solution that ensures its continued presence in the U.S.

This announcement comes as tensions have mounted over the platform’s Chinese ownership, with U.S. officials raising questions about user data security and potential foreign influence.
